#### `FIO_STREAM_COPY_PER_PACKET`

```c
#define FIO_STREAM_COPY_PER_PACKET 98304
```

Break apart large memory blocks into smaller pieces. by default 96Kb

_Symbol type:_ `macro`

#### `FIO_STREAM_ALWAYS_COPY_IF_LESS_THAN`

```c
#define FIO_STREAM_ALWAYS_COPY_IF_LESS_THAN 116
```

If the data added is less than said bytes, copy is preferred (locality).

#### `fio_stream_read`

```c
void fio_stream_read(fio_stream_s *stream, char **buf, size_t *len)
```

Reads data from the stream (if any), leaving it in the stream.

`buf` MUST point to a buffer with - at least - `len` bytes. This is required
in case the packed data is fragmented or references a file and needs to be
copied to an available buffer.

On error, or if the stream is empty, `buf` will be set to NULL and `len` will
be set to zero.

Otherwise, `buf` may retain the same value or it may point directly to a
memory address within the stream's buffer (the original value may be lost)
and `len` will be updated to the largest possible value for valid data that
can be read from `buf`.

Note: this isn't thread safe.

#### `fio_stream_advance`

```c
void fio_stream_advance(fio_stream_s *stream, size_t len)
```

Advances the Stream, so the first `len` bytes are marked as consumed.

Note: this isn't thread safe.
